HB4294 by Holland ( Relating to the creation of the North Celina Municipal Management District No. 3; providing a limited authority of eminent domain; providing authority to impose taxes, levy assessments, and issue bonds.), Committee Report 1st House, Substituted

No f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.

The bill would amend the Special District Local Laws Code establishing the North Celina Municipal Management District No. 3. The district would have authority for improvement projects and services. The district would have authority to impose and collect assessments. The district would have authority to issue bonds and other obligations. The district would not have authority to exercise the power of eminent domain unless the district obtains written consent from the governing body of the city.  

The bill would take effect September 1, 2017.

Local Government Impact

No signific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
